about

SIXSTEP is proud to announce the release of their new single, “Middle Ground”.

Originally released as an acoustic track on "A Dangerous World", "Middle Ground" was arranged by bassist Jason Peed for the "Dangerous World" album release concert on 4 April 2009. Melancholic horn melodies interweave with Al Rahn's expressive vocals, all set to the backdrop of Elliot Koenig's dark, swampy, Robert Johnson-esque guitar. The song also marks tenor player Ricky Hopkins' first recording as a permanent member of Sixstep.

The lyrics reflect on a turbulent affair between vocalist Al Rahn, his girlfriend, and his best friend around the time he joined SIXSTEP. To amplify the themes of uncertainty, longing and confusion, “Middle Ground” was recorded unplugged for "A DANGEROUS WORLD", and this album version is included on this single release.

A music video for “Middle Ground” is also currently in post-production by Blue Artists Films, and will be released in September 2010.
